Transaction 57c236d7d7bd3d52a27770ddc77fa08aacb63b35ae7b2d286b5ed525c23a4914

3 Input
1 Outputs
  • 57c236d7d7bd3d52a27770ddc77fa08aacb63b35ae7b2d286b5ed525c23a4914:0
  • value  625905
    address  3LZNenxBJPt9U4TyATp6aFDQj5krKrU38w